Historical Perspective: From Mechanical Reels to Digital Platforms
In the beginning, slot machines like the famous Liberty Bell, invented in 1895, utilised mechanical reels with physical symbols. These simple devices relied on fixed odds and manual operation, but their appeal stemmed from the thrill of chance. As technology advanced, electro-mechanical machines emerged in the mid-20th century, adding electronic components that enabled more complex gameplay and increased payout variability.
However, the real revolution arrived with the advent of digital technology. Digital displays, microprocessors, and networked systems allowed policymakers and operators to introduce a plethora of game themes, bonus features, and progressive jackpots—all managed through software. This shift not only increased entertainment value but also enabled greater regulatory control and data collection, critical for adapting to gambling legislation and casino management strategies.
Technological Milestones Shaping Modern Slot Machines
| Year | Innovation |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| 1976 | First Video Slot Machine | Transition from mechanical reels; allows for more complex gameplay and themes. |
| 1996 | Introduction of Networked Slots | Remote data management; enhanced tracking and promotional capabilities. | 2000s | Online Slots and Mobile Compatibility | Access to « popular slot machines » from anywhere; broader demographic reach. |
| 2010 onwards | Enhanced Graphics & Interactive Features | Immersive experience; integration of casino-quality visuals and sound. |
